In this episode, we celebrate Pride Month by discussing its significance, the history of the Stonewall Riots, and the ongoing struggles faced by the LGBTQ+ community. We share personal experiences, highlight the importance of female solidarity, and address the impact of activism on mental health and community support.


The conversation also touches on the dynamics of public breakups in politics (iykyk), the importance of understanding gender dynamics, and the need for accessible mental health care for LGBTQ+ youth.
